HEA ameliorates gastric dysmotility in DGP by suppressing the cGAS-STING pathway, attenuating M2 macrophage pyroptosis and inflammatory responses, and preserving ICC networks. These findings identify a novel EA/cGAS-STING/pyroptosis axis and highlight its therapeutic potential as a mechanistic target for optimizing DGP treatment strategies.
